How they compare
Finland currently reports 1.35 million against 1.33 million in Czechia, a difference of 22,950.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Czechia ahead.
Czechia ranks 113th and Finland ranks 111th of 153 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Czechia averaged higher in 6 and Finland in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Czechia | Finland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 1.03 million | 475,071 | 559,091 | Czechia |
| 1970s | 1.12 million | 576,151 | 544,963 | Czechia |
| 1980s | 1.19 million | 735,544 | 459,198 | Czechia |
| 1990s | 1.20 million | 938,373 | 257,884 | Czechia |
| 2000s | 1.20 million | 1.06 million | 132,331 | Czechia |
| 2010s | 1.27 million | 1.21 million | 53,699 | Czechia |
| 2020s | 1.32 million | 1.33 million | 11,602 | Finland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
